Mesembria, Thrace, 300 - 250 B.C.
|Mesembria|, |Mesembria,| |Thrace,| |300| |-| |250| |B.C.|, The wheel on the reverse is depicted with a degree of perspective, which is unusual on ancient coins.
GB75131. Bronze AE 22, SNG Stancomb 229, SNG Cop 658, SNG BM 276 var. (helmet left), VF, Mesambria (Nesebar, Bulgaria) mint, weight 5.837g, maximum diameter 21.9mm, 300 - 250 B.C.; obverse Thracian helmet with cheek guard right; reverse METAMBPIANΩN (T = archaic Greek letter sampi = ΣΣ), wheel with hub; rare; SOLD
